Understanding Sleep Issues in the Elderly
Sleep disturbances are common among older adults due to various factors such as hormonal changes, medical conditions, medications, and lifestyle changes. As a result, many elderly individuals may find themselves struggling with insomnia or poor sleep quality. This is where sleep supplements can play a vital role.
Top Sleep Supplements for the Elderly
1. Melatonin
Melatonin is a hormone that regulates the sleep-wake cycle. As we age, our bodies produce less melatonin, leading to difficulties in falling asleep. Melatonin supplements can help signal the body that it is time to sleep, making it easier for elderly individuals to fall asleep faster and improve overall sleep quality.
How to Use: A typical dose ranges from 0.5 mg to 5 mg taken 30 to 60 minutes before bedtime.
2. Magnesium
Magnesium is an essential mineral known for its calming properties. It plays a crucial role in regulating neurotransmitters that promote sleep. Many elderly individuals are magnesium-deficient, which can contribute to insomnia and restless sleep.
How to Use: The recommended daily allowance for magnesium is about 320 mg for women and 420 mg for men. Supplements can be taken in various forms, including capsules and powders.
3. Valerian Root
Valerian root is an herbal remedy that has been used for centuries to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ality. It is believed to increase levels of g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A), a neurotransmitter that helps regulate sleep.
How to Use: Valerian root is typically taken in capsule form or as a tea. A common dosage is 300 to 600 mg taken 30 minutes before bedtime.
4. L-Theanine
L-theanine is an amino acid found in tea leaves that promotes relaxation without causing drowsiness. It can help reduce anxiety and improve sleep quality, making it an excellent option for the elderly who may have racing thoughts at night.
How to Use: The usual dose ranges from 100 mg to 400 mg, taken before bedtime.
5. 5-HTP (5-Hydroxytryptophan)
5-HTP is a naturally occurring amino acid that increases serotonin levels in the brain, which can help regulate sleep patterns. It is often used for mood enhancement and improving sleep quality.
How to Use: A typical dosage is between 50 mg and 300 mg, taken before bedtime.
Important Considerations
While sleep supplements can be beneficial, it is essential for elderly individuals to consult with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ement regimen. This is especially important for those who are taking other medications or have existing health conditions.
Potential Side Effects
Some sleep supplements may cause side effects, including daytime drowsiness, dizziness, or gastrointestinal upset. Monitoring the body’s response to any new supplement is crucial.
Lifestyle Changes
In addition to supplements, incorporating healthy sleep habits can greatly enhance sleep quality. This includes maintaining a regular sleep schedule, creating a calming bedtime routine, and ensuring a comfortable sleep environment.
